Job Summary
The Museum Store Associate supports the Getty stores as a professional and outgoing sales associate, operates a POS system, applies basic computer skills, and engages visitors in a friendly and professional manner. Museum Store Associates also manage financial transactions and assist with store upkeep, including inventory maintenance and routine cleaning.
Major Job Responsibilities
Provides excellent customer service, ensuring a positive guest experience
- Efficiently and accurately operate point-of-sale (POS) registers
- Handles financial transactions responsibly with accuracy according to department procedures
- Exhibits knowledge of store merchandise, exhibitions, events, and an understanding of Getty policies and procedures specific to the assigned work location
- Prepares store and / or satellite locations by restocking displays, maintaining store cleanliness, and preserving the overall presentation of the retail space
- May be assigned shifts in the warehouse or at an alternate store location
